Palmer Square Apts. is a Project-Based Section 8 community in Chicago, IL with 160 units reporting 94% occupancy. Assisted residents pay about $479/month on average.

Resident & program facts (HUD-reported)

Program(s)Project-Based Section 8, Low-Income Housing Tax Credit (LIHTC)
Address2128 N Kedzie Blvd, Chicago, IL 60647 Map →
Average household income$19,645/yr
Average personal income$12,983/yr
People per unit1.5
Moved in within last year1%
Households below 30% AMI78%
Households below 50% AMI92%
One-bedroom share72%

How to apply at Palmer Square Apts.

LIHTC tax-credit: units reserved for households within set income bands renting below market rate. Apply at the leasing office; you'll need steady income within limits.

  1. Call or visit the management office at 2128 N Kedzie Blvd, Chicago; ask if the waitlist is open and request an application.
  2. Gather ID, Social Security cards, birth certificates, and proof of all income. Applications are always free.
  3. Claim eligible preferences (homelessness, veteran, local residency) with documentation.
  4. Respond fast to interview letters; verify rent expectations against your budget (~$479/mo average here).

How much is rent at Palmer Square Apts.?
Residents report average rents near $479/month in HUD administrative data. Under most federal programs you pay roughly 30% of adjusted income — your actual amount depends on household income and unit size.
